Study Questions Whether Instruction Following Relies on a Single LLM Mechanism

A new arXiv paper examines whether instruction tuning gives language models a general-purpose ability to follow instructions or whether the behavior emerges from coordinated, task-specific components. The authors argue the evidence points to skillful coordination rather than one universal mechanism. The work adds to ongoing debate about what instruction tuning actually changes inside a model.

arXiv Paper Probes Knowledge Attribution to Distinguish Hallucination Types in LLMs

A new arXiv preprint proposes probing methods to trace where large language models source their knowledge, aiming to separate two kinds of hallucination. The authors distinguish faithfulness violations, where a model mishandles context it was given, from factuality violations, where its answers stem from incorrect stored knowledge. The work targets better attribution of model outputs to internal knowledge versus supplied context.

arXiv paper proposes Hilbert-valued framework for explaining time-dependent model outputs

A new preprint introduces a decomposition method that extends feature-attribution explanations from single-number predictions to functional or multivariate outputs, such as demand forecasts that vary over time. The approach works in a Hilbert space so that the influence of each input feature can be separated across the whole output trajectory rather than summarized by one score. The authors position it as a general framework for settings where model predictions are curves or vectors instead of scalars.
